PARK POLICIES AND GUIDELINES 

**New Policy Effective 2024 - NO PERSONAL GOLF CARTS for Transient stays are allowed on property***

QUIET HOURS: 10:30 PM - 7 AM. Please be courteous of neighbors. Please be at your site/cabin by 10:30 PM. 

POOL RULES: Swim at your own risk.  Lifeguards are not provided at Marval Camping Resort. All children under the age of 14 must be accompanied by an adult. Please follow posted pool rules. No glass containers. 

SPEED LIMIT is 10 MPH. Watch for children at play. Pedestrians have the right of way. 

VEHICLES: Two vehicles per site (additional vehicles park in designated areas.) Please display your car pass always while in the park.  Every vehicle should have a car pass visible, any vehicles without a parking pass are liable to be removed from the property or asked to leave.

REGISTERD GUESTS:  All guests staying with you need to be registered on your registration.  Armbands will be issued according to your approved amount of registered guests.  You may purchase additional armbands for day use at the Welcome Center, any guests without an armband can be asked to vacate the premises.   A Day use waiver is required and all guests are subject to the parks rules and regulations while on site. 

FIREWORKS AND FIREARMS ARE STRICTLY PROHIBITED. This includes BB, Airsoft and pellet guns. LEOs may request an exception.

GOLF CARTS:  No one in the campground under 18 years of age can drive a golf cart or sit behind the wheel with keys in.  Failure to adhere for ANY reason WILL result in the golf cart being confiscated with no refund.  OFF ROADING RECREATIONAL VEHICLES INCLUDING BUT NOT LIMITED TO PRIVATE GOLF CARTS BOTH GAS AND ELECTRIC, ATV/4 WHEELERS, MOTORIZED OR BATTERY OPERATED SCOOTERS, HOVERBOARDS, RIDE ON TOYS, ETC. ARE NOT ALLOWED ON MARVAL PROPERTY.   Golf carts are available for rental from 12 pm to 12 pm and are put away at 5:30 PM.  All late check-ins will have to pick up their golf cart the following day during office hours.  A waiver must be signed and a copy of ALL driver's licenses of drivers on file. NO EXCEPTIONS.

BICYCLES: For the safety of our children, bicycle riding is welcome during daylight hours only and is prohibited on the big hill near the front entrance. You may bring bikes, trikes, skateboards, and wagons. For the safety and privacy of our guests, flying drones on Marval premises is NOT ALLOWED.  

CAMPFIRES are allowed in the firepits only. No hanging of clothes, etc. outside of RV's or on trees. 

GARBAGE: Please take your trash to the trash compactor at the far end of the big field by the storage area.  There are no other trash cans in the park.

ALCOHOLIC BEVERAGES: When drinking, we ask that you do so responsibly. This is a family friendly campground; we have zero tolerance policy for public intoxication. 

SMOKING: Smoking is prohibited in all campground buildings, cabins, playground, or pool/water areas. Please dispose of butts in provided receptacles. 

All site changes need to be approved by registration desk. Park management has the right to move vehicles or belongings without notice or liability in an emergency. 

Refunds are not given for early departure or for the whims of mother nature.

ALL CAMPGROUND GUIDELINES must be followed by everyone in your party including visitors.  Management reserves the right to ask anyone to leave the park for breaking policies with NO refund. 

 

LODGING RENTAL POLICIES

CHECK IN TIME IS 4:00 PM. CHECK OUT TIME IS 11:00 AM. Check in and check out times are strictly enforced, exceptions made are by management approval only, $40 fee will be applied. We can NOT guarantee your site will be ready until 4 PM.  You are welcome to come in to the park as early as noon and enjoy our amenities without an additional fee and return for your cabin/lodge keys at 4 pm.  Linens and towels are not provided in our cabins and lodges you will need to bring your own.  Kitchens are stocked to provide for the maximum amount of guests allowed per site.

AT CHECK OUT please clean out all cabinets and the refrigerator of your personal items. All dishes should be washed and put away. Please take your trash to the dumpster. If the cabin is not in order, you will be liable for extra cleaning charges. The registered Guest on your cabin will be responsible and charged for any damages that occur during your stay. Please bring your cabin key to the office upon check out. Missing or lost keys will result in a $25.00 fee.  We ask that you honor our check out time to minimize hardship on our staff and the next guests arriving.  Late fees will be applied for keys not recieved by 11 AM. 

CABIN/LODGING FACILITES CAN ONLY BE RENTED BY AN ADULT 21 YEARS OR OLDER. This adult MUST BE STAYING IN THE FACILITY. The number of people in each cabin is to be no more than the stated maximum number for the cabin you rented.

Tents are not allowed on cabin/lodge sites.

ANY PROBLEMS or damage you might find with your lodging, please inform us immediately.  Any unreported damages discovered upon check out will result in damage fees.

SMOKING is not permitted in any cabin, lodging or any campground building. Evidence of smoking in cabin or lodging will result in a $250.00 charge.

Pet Friendly Policy:  Cabins or Lodges - We welcome your pet to our campground. All that you need to do is let us know that you are bringing a pet and we will book you into a pet friendly cabin or lodge subject to availability.  We charge a $25.00 non-refundable cleaning fee per stay (2 Pet Limit). We have cabins and lodges set aside for pets and their owners since some of our other guests are allergic to pets. Unfortunately, if your pet persuades you to sneak him or her into a non-pet friendly cabin or lodge, you will be liable for $300 in cleaning charges.  We expect that you will take good care of your pet which includes not leaving your pet unattended inside or outside.  Erecting any type of fence or pen around your site is prohibited.  When your pet is taking you for a walk, it must be on a leash – making sure that you clean up after him or her. 

 

RV & TENT RENTAL POLICIES: 

RV and Tent check-in is 2 PM and check-out is 12PM.  Check in and check out times are strictly enforced, exceptions made are by management approval only, $40 fee will be applied. we can NOT guarantee your site will be ready until 2 PM.

RV's are ONLY allowed on designated RV locations, this includes pop-up's.  Tents are not allowed on sites where an RV is present. Limit of 6 people per site.

Tents are allowed on either tent or RV sites without an RV.  Limit of 2 tents per site, 6 people per site.

STATE LAW: All RVs are required to have an approved sewer ring/donut to prevent spillage and odor. 

Pet Friendly Policy:  RV Sites - We welcome your pet to our campground.  All that you need to do is let us know that you are bringing a pet.  There will be no charge for bringing your pet with your RV.  We expect that you will take good care of your pet which includes not leaving your pet unattended outside.  Erecting any type of fence or pen around your site is prohibited.  When your pet is taking you for a walk, it must be on a leash – making sure that you clean up after him or her. There is a limit of 2 pets per site.
